The game is taking place at the Akana Cricket Stadium situated in the Indian city of Lucknow.


Lucknow: In the 14th match of the ICC ODI World Cup 2023, Sri Lanka is pitted against Australia in an exciting cricket showdown.
After 28 overs, the Sri Lankan team has managed to accumulate a total of 165 runs, having lost just 3 wickets in the process.
Pathum Nissanka of the Lincoln team played a crucial role by scoring 61 runs but was eventually dismissed by Pete Cummins.
The match venue for this intense clash is the Akana Cricket Stadium, located in the Indian city of Lucknow.
Sri Lanka, having won the toss, opted to bat first, setting the stage for a fierce encounter.
Both Sri Lanka and Australia are currently participating in their third match of the tournament.
Notably, both teams encountered losses in their initial two matches.
This game will prove pivotal in their quest for redemption and improving their position in the points table.
As of the latest standings, Sri Lanka holds the eighth position on the points table, while Australia is positioned at the tenth spot.
